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Redwood Report2Web versions 4.3.4.5 and 4.5.3
Description
A cross-site scripting (XSS) issue in the login panel allows remote attackers to inject JavaScript via the "signIn.do" API endpoint, specifically through the
urll parameter. This enables attackers to execute malicious scripts on the client-side.Recommendations
For Redwood Report2Web version 4.3.4.5, consider disabling the
signIn.do API endpoint until a patch is available.
For Redwood Report2Web version 4.5.3, restrict access to the urll parameter in the signIn.do API endpoint to minimize the risk of exploitation.
As a temporary workaround, avoid using the urll parameter in the signIn.do API endpoint until the issue is resolved.Exploit
